[cairo-bugs] [Bug 5433] crash in _cairo_ft_scaled_glyph_init()

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Mon Jan 2 14:36:19 PST 2006


Please do not reply to this email: if you want to comment on the bug, go to    
       
the URL shown below and enter yourcomments there.     
   
https://bugs.freedesktop.org/show_bug.cgi?id=5433          
     




------- Additional Comments From christian.kirbach at student.uni-siegen.de  2006-01-03 09:32 -------
I've just come across this again this time with Gnome 2.13

Backtrace was generated from '/opt/gnome214/bin/gnome-about'

Using host libthread_db library "/lib/tls/libthread_db.so.1".
`system-supplied DSO at 0xffffe000' has disappeared; keeping its symbols.
[Thread debugging using libthread_db enabled]
[New Thread -1226511680 (LWP 2457)]
0xb75bb20e in __waitpid_nocancel () from /lib/tls/libpthread.so.0
#0  0xb75bb20e in __waitpid_nocancel () from /lib/tls/libpthread.so.0
#1  0xb7ec22ed in libgnomeui_segv_handle (signum=-512) at gnome-ui-init.c:784
#2  <signal handler called>
#3  0xb76acd04 in _cairo_ft_scaled_glyph_init (abstract_font=0x83fdf70, 
    scaled_glyph=0x8408448, info=CAIRO_SCALED_GLYPH_INFO_SURFACE)
    at cairo-ft-font.c:1084
#4  0xb769fb32 in _cairo_scaled_glyph_lookup (scaled_font=0x83fdf70, index=1, 
    info=) at cairo-scaled-font.c:1174
#5  0xb76a053f in _cairo_scaled_font_show_glyphs (scaled_font=0x83fdf70, 
    op=CAIRO_OPERATOR_OVER, pattern=0xbf90c420, surface=0x8401908, 
    source_x=2, source_y=7, dest_x=2, dest_y=7, width=60, height=15, 
    glyphs=0x82af0a0, num_glyphs=5) at cairo-scaled-font.c:827
#6  0xb76a3f41 in _cairo_surface_old_show_glyphs_draw_func (
    closure=0xbf90c390, op=CAIRO_OPERATOR_OVER, src=0xbf90c420, 
    dst=0x8401908, dst_x=0, dst_y=0, extents=0xbf90c3a4)
    at cairo-surface-fallback.c:887
#7  0xb76a2e86 in _clip_and_composite (clip=0x0, op=CAIRO_OPERATOR_OVER, 
    src=0xbf90c420, 
    draw_func=0xb76a3dd0 <_cairo_surface_old_show_glyphs_draw_func>, 
    draw_closure=0xbf90c390, dst=0x8401908, extents=0xbf90c3a4)
    at cairo-surface-fallback.c:391
#8  0xb76a4030 in _cairo_surface_fallback_show_glyphs (surface=0x8401908, 
    op=CAIRO_OPERATOR_OVER, source=0xbf90c420, glyphs=0x82af0a0, 
    num_glyphs=5, scaled_font=0x83fdf70) at cairo-surface-fallback.c:937
#9  0xb76a272f in _cairo_surface_show_glyphs (surface=0x8401908, 
    op=CAIRO_OPERATOR_OVER, source=0xbf90c420, glyphs=0x82af0a0, 
    num_glyphs=5, scaled_font=0x83fdf70) at cairo-surface.c:1402
#10 0xb76990ef in _cairo_gstate_show_glyphs (gstate=0x83f4aa0, 
    glyphs=0xbf90c538, num_glyphs=5) at cairo-gstate.c:1455
#11 0xb7694a03 in cairo_show_glyphs (cr=0x84012f8, glyphs=0xbf90c538, 
    num_glyphs=5) at cairo.c:2158
#12 0xb771852d in pango_cairo_renderer_draw_glyphs (renderer=0x0, font=0x0, 
    glyphs=0x82ad5b8, x=0, y=0) at pangocairo-render.c:132
#13 0xb76fa885 in pango_renderer_draw_glyphs (renderer=0x8275b68, font=0x0, 
    glyphs=0x0, x=0, y=0) at pango-renderer.c:598
#14 0xb7718ba7 in pango_cairo_show_glyph_string (cr=0x84012f8, 
    font=0x8185aa0, glyphs=0x82ad5b8) at pangocairo-render.c:336
#15 0xb778b1fb in gdk_pango_renderer_draw_glyphs (renderer=0x0, 
    font=0x8185aa0, glyphs=0x82ad5b8, x=0, y=20) at gdkpango.c:210
#16 0xb76fa885 in pango_renderer_draw_glyphs (renderer=0x827b540, font=0x0, 
    glyphs=0x0, x=0, y=0) at pango-renderer.c:598
#17 0xb76fbacf in pango_renderer_draw_layout_line (renderer=0x827b540, 
    line=0x8356858, x=0, y=20480) at pango-renderer.c:529
#18 0xb76fbe9a in pango_renderer_draw_layout (renderer=0x827b540, 
    layout=0x81c2288, x=0, y=0) at pango-renderer.c:182
#19 0xb778cf29 in IA__gdk_draw_layout_with_colors (drawable=0x81c25b0, 
    gc=0x82710b8, x=0, y=0, layout=0x81c2288, foreground=0x0, background=0x0)
    at gdkpango.c:989
#20 0xb778d0ed in IA__gdk_draw_layout (drawable=0x81c25b0, gc=0x82710b8, x=0, 
    y=0, layout=0x81c2288) at gdkpango.c:1051
#21 0xb7b1aa30 in gnome_canvas_text_draw (item=0x80cfd30, drawable=0x0, 
    x=409, y=269, width=64, height=29) at gnome-canvas-text.c:1471
#22 0xb7b234dd in gnome_canvas_group_draw (item=0x0, drawable=0x81c25b0, 
    x=409, y=269, width=64, height=29) at gnome-canvas.c:1680
#23 0xb7b234dd in gnome_canvas_group_draw (item=0x0, drawable=0x81c25b0, 
    x=409, y=269, width=64, height=29) at gnome-canvas.c:1680
#24 0xb7b29076 in gnome_canvas_expose (widget=0x80ca508, event=0xbf90d240)
    at gnome-canvas.c:2992
#25 0xb790c31e in _gtk_marshal_BOOLEAN__BOXED (closure=0x80a2488, 
    return_value=0xbf90ceb0, n_param_values=2, param_values=0xbf90cf9c, 
    invocation_hint=0xbf90ce9c, marshal_data=0xb7b289e0) at gtkmarshalers.c:83
#26 0xb7658ae9 in g_type_class_meta_marshal (closure=0x80a2488, 
    return_value=0x0, n_param_values=0, param_values=0xbf90cf9c, 
    invocation_hint=0x0, marshal_data=0x0) at gclosure.c:567
#27 0xb765914d in IA__g_closure_invoke (closure=0x80a2488, return_value=0x0, 
    n_param_values=0, param_values=0x0, invocation_hint=0x0) at gclosure.c:490
#28 0xb766a2c8 in signal_emit_unlocked_R (node=0x80a2398, detail=0, 
    instance=0x80ca508, emission_return=0xbf90d11c, 
    instance_and_params=0xbf90cf9c) at gsignal.c:2476
#29 0xb766b773 in IA__g_signal_emit_valist (instance=0x80ca508, signal_id=48, 
    detail=0, 
    var_args=0xbf90d1a0 "¸Ñ\220¿@Ò\220¿\b¥\f\bO\237\237·\b¥\f\bÀr\t\b")
    at gsignal.c:2207
#30 0xb766bd59 in IA__g_signal_emit (instance=0x0, signal_id=0, detail=0)
    at gsignal.c:2241
#31 0xb79f9e06 in gtk_widget_event_internal (widget=0x80ca508, 
    event=0xbf90d240) at gtkwidget.c:3735
#32 0xb7b259df in do_update (canvas=0x80ca508) at gnome-canvas.c:3104
#33 0xb7b25a7c in idle_handler (data=0x0) at gnome-canvas.c:3184
#34 0xb75e8ea1 in g_idle_dispatch (source=0x82875f8, 
    callback=0xb7b25a40 <idle_handler>, user_data=0x0) at gmain.c:3761
#35 0xb75e6a03 in IA__g_main_context_dispatch (context=0x8088c38)
    at gmain.c:1913
#36 0xb75e9c7b in g_main_context_iterate (context=0x8088c38, block=1, 
    dispatch=1, self=0x80582a8) at gmain.c:2544
#37 0xb75e9f87 in IA__g_main_loop_run (loop=0x8277050) at gmain.c:2748
#38 0xb7909dd3 in IA__gtk_main () at gtkmain.c:991
#39 0x0804c64e in main (argc=0, argv=0x0) at gnome-about.c:1211

Thread 1 (Thread -1226511680 (LWP 2457)):
#0  0xb75bb20e in __waitpid_nocancel () from /lib/tls/libpthread.so.0
No symbol table info available.
#1  0xb7ec22ed in libgnomeui_segv_handle (signum=-512) at gnome-ui-init.c:784
	estatus = 262116
	in_segv = 1
	sa = {__sigaction_handler = {sa_handler = 0, sa_sigaction = 0}, 
  sa_mask = {__val = {0, 3074783324, 3213933480, 3074308391, 134724656, 0, 2, 
      3070819735, 135724056, 0, 3213933576, 3074195469, 134724656, 
      3213933540, 2, 3068455584, 3213933540, 3068455584, 16684, 44, 0, 0, 44, 
      66150, 135725118, 134729720, 44, 138471168, 16640, 196, 1, 
      3074783324}}, sa_flags = 380, sa_restorer = 0xbf90be40}
	pid = #0  0xb75bb20e in __waitpid_nocancel ()
   from /lib/tls/libpthread.so.0
          
     
     
--           
Configure bugmail: https://bugs.freedesktop.org/userprefs.cgi?tab=email         
     
------- You are receiving this mail because: -------
You are the QA contact for the bug, or are watching the QA contact.


More information about the cairo-bugs mailing list